Honda Launches Free Airbag Safety Recall Campaign in Nepal

Africa15 hr ago

Syakar Trading Company, the official Honda car distributor in Nepal, has initiated a free safety recall campaign to address potential risks identified in the airbags of older Honda car models. This initiative prioritizes customer safety by proactively resolving issues with the airbag systems. The recall specifically targets Honda cars manufactured between the years 2001 and 2014. Several popular models, including the Honda City and others, are affected by this campaign. The company is offering this service free of charge to ensure that all affected customers can have their vehicle's airbags inspected and repaired or replaced if necessary.
